A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, has been found in 74CMS 3.28.0. Affected by this issue is the function sendCompanyLogo of the file /controller/company/Index.php#sendCompanyLogo of the component Company Logo Handler. The manipulation of the argument imgBase64 leads to unrestricted upload. The attack may be launched rem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ier of this vulnerability is VDB-257060.

Risk analysis

Based on its CVSS vector, this vulnerability is exploitable over the network, low attack complexity, requiring low privileges, no user interaction. Successful exploitation leads to low impact to confidentiality, low impact to integrity, low impact to availability.

Its EPSS score of 6.1% reflects a lower probability of exploitation activity in the wild over the next 30 days, placing it above 93% of all scored CVEs.
